      Honda has demanded victory in this year’s Bosch Australian Rally Championship.

      Honda Australia unveiled its two new Jazz rally cars at Bosch’s headquarters in Melbourne yesterday, and lead driver Eli Evans admits the pressure will be on to perform.

      “I’ve been told this year, we must win,” Evans told Speedcafe.com.

      “Honda said “What do we need to win?” and we said “a G2 car with the new regulations.”

      “They gave us the new Honda Jazz, and so far so good. It feels fantastic. It feels like an improvement on the Honda Civic Type R.”

      The cars will be driven by Evans and Mark Pedder and will make their debut at the inaugural Rally Calder next weekend.

                      For todays update we have a H22a Civic and 4age AE71 Corolla entered .



                      Billy’s Ae71 may look like and unfinished, unpainted project, but pop open the bonnet or even stick your head under the car and its full of goodies with everything there to make it go sideways or put down a decent lap.

                      See Billy’s Ae71 at the Grip Shift Slide’s show and shine section of Forum Battle.



                      Normally found in the engine bay of a 4th gen Prelude. The conversion may be unorthodox, but for one third of the price of a k20 swap its a bang for buck swap. Running a 14.5 down the quarter with a stock H22A , Phouc’s Civic has proven to give some turbo cars a run for their money.

                      At Forum Battle , we’ll be seeing the H22A Civic at full V-Tec in the Gymkhana event.
